Top Definition
A slang term for the act of firmly squeezing your butt cheeks together to prevent bowel release, to the point that you cannot hold back anymore and you discharge fecal matter into your pants. The result is often associated with a carrot-like scent.
Aww dude, if I don't get to the bathroom quick, I'm totally gonna fegley myself.
by Beans2000 February 04,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.